When choosing between acquiring a franchise business and beginning a brand-new company, probably the very best place to begin is to ask on your own why you intend to possess an organization.




If your response is that you intend to have your own service due to the fact that of the freedom it will certainly bring you, you probably should not get a franchise. If you acquire a franchise business, the franchisor will determine much of what you have to do, when you have to do it, and how you have to do it.
